Pokemon fans should keep an eye on August 20, as that's when Gamescom Opening Night Live takes place. For Pokemon enthusiasts who may not be aware of what it is, Gamescom is essentially Europe's equivalent of E3/Summer Game Fest, with the event home to all kinds of big announcements and reveals over the years. This year's Gamescom will technically take place from August 21 to 25, but the event will kick off with a special Gamescom Opening Night Live presentation hosted by The Game Awards host Geoff Keighley.
As one of the year's biggest gaming events, many major companies make sure to attend Gamescom to show off their upcoming products. However, some of the industry's biggest companies will actually be skipping this year's Gamescom. It's been confirmed that PlayStation will not be at Gamescom this year, and neither will Nintendo. But while Nintendo itself won't be at Gamescom, a company associated with it has been confirmed for the event.
